EA Javelin Anti-Cheat Returns Error 95 after Javelin May 21 Update
Unlike some other posts on this forum, this issue has not been happening since a specific Battlefield 6 season, rather possibly an update to the Javelin anti-cheat that was on May 21 (link goes to SteamDB depot change for Javelin on May 21) Currently when trying to boot up Battlefield 6, one of two things will happen:
- Sometimes the game will crash after booted up for like a minute
- Most of the time will show the anti-cheat error before going into full-screen.
Here's what I've tried already:
- Clearing the "settings" folder under "%userprofile%/Documents/Battlefield 6" (user settings obviously)
- Repairing the game via Steam (Right click game > "Properties" > "Installed Files" > "Verify integrity (...)")
- Reinstalling the game via Steam
- Reinstalling Javelin--twice
- Checking BIOS for both Secure Boot & TPM (which would show a different error but is common)
- Disabling all non-Microsoft services EXCEPT FOR anything under Valve/Steam & EA/Javelin and also disabling any startup applications via Task Manager
- The reason for the two exceptions for the services are of course for launching the game fully.
All of this and no changes.
